A group sustainability therapy with an AIA LU credit! Sharing real sustainability project execution, material selection, and impact.
About this Event

Sustainability isn’t the headline anymore. It’s the expectation. But how?

The real question in 2026: who’s actually executing?

The goals are clear. The friction is real. And most firms are somewhere between “we’ve started” and “we’re stuck.” Architectural and Design teams are navigating embodied and operational carbon, material health, transparency, circularity, budgets and client pressure - all at once. This session cuts through theory and gets into what’s actually working on commercial projects right now.

Structured as a dynamic panel discussion, this event brings together leaders from architecture, design, ownership, and construction to unpack:

  • How teams are reducing carbon without blowing up budgets
  • Where implementation still breaks down
  • How to align internal teams and external partners
  • What small, repeatable actions are compounding into measurable impact

Expect practical insight, honest conversation, and tangible takeaways you can apply immediately to active projects.
